Battle of Dagorlad

The battle was fought on the plain before the Black Gate of Mordor, and there the host of the Last Alliance had the mastery: neither Gil-galad's spear Aiglos nor Elendil's sword Narsil could be withstood. Elrond rode in it as Gil-galad's herald. The victory did not end the war; the siege of Barad-dûr began after it, and Sauron himself was not overthrown until the last combat on the slopes of Orodruin.
